    Sorry to jump on this thread but what ratio’s do you guys use?

    Currently looking into making my old frame up into a single speed.

    Is a 38t front and 16t rear to much for trails? Or is it to ‘spinny’ for road.

    I intend to join a local road club for small 20 mile rides at a avg speed of 16-18mph. with the 38/16 combo.

    darrell
    Free Member

    32:16 on mine. Its a good compromise for trails and commuting

    kazafaza
    Free Member

    32:14 Genesis iO SS

    yunki
    Free Member

    I’m running 32:16 on a rigid Soul, which for me is a good compromise for about 50/50 road/off-road use..

    The road sections for me though are just a means to an end, and I prefer to ride fairly technical trails.. with this in mind I’m erring towards a 32:18 set up and aiming to reduce the amount of time on road as much as poss.. (cos it’s just no fun)
